Fairfield Republicans Endorse Jim Meyers After Testani Resignation
Republican Jack Testani resigned from the Fairfield Board of Finance this week.

FAIRFIELD, CT — Two days after Republican Jack Testani resigned, Fairfield Republicans are backing Jim Meyers to replace him on the Board of Finance, party officials announced.
Testani's resignation took effect immediately, but his term is not scheduled to expire until November 2025.
Meyers, who ran unsuccessfully for the board in 2023, is a Certified Public Accountant and Chief Financial Officer, who "brings a wealth of experience in finance and management."

"He is a respected member of the Fairfield community, and his professional expertise makes him exceptionally qualified to serve on the Board of Finance," the Fairfield Republican Town Committee wrote in a statement.
Meyers is a lifelong Fairfield resident, and lives with his wife, Sharon, a public school teacher. The two raised three children, all of whom attended Fairfield schools.

Testani, who had served on the Board of Finance for the past five years, is leaving the board to relocate out of town, according to Laura Devlin, Chair of the Fairfield RTC.
"Jack has been a dedicated member of the Board of Finance," Devlin said. "We are grateful for his service and while we are sorry to see him leave Fairfield, we wish him and his wife Suzanne well in their new endeavors."
Testani's replacement, who must be a Republican, requires approval by the Board of Selectmen, and the Fairfield RTC has requested that Meyers' name be placed on the agenda for the next regularly scheduled Board of Selectmen meeting for consideration.
"I'm excited about the potential opportunity to bring my experience in finance, and time on the RTM, to the Board of Finance," Meyers said in a statement during the nominating process. "As a CFO and CPA, I'm ready to help ensure that our town's financial resources are managed responsibly and transparently."
Added current Board of Finance Member, Jim Walsh, "Jim's extensive background in finance and commitment to our community will be a tremendous asset to the Board of Finance."
